Inclusion criteria
Inclusion criteria: 1.Female age > 40-70 year 2. Underwent mammography at the study sites (Maharaj Chiangmai hospital or Songklanagarind hospital)
Exclusion criteria
Exclusion criteria: 1) End-stage kidney disease on hemodialysis 2) Breast cancer 3) Prior breast trauma, breast surgery or breast implantation 4) History of CABG or coronary stent
